Types of Compensation Available
Victims of mesothelioma in Louisiana can seek compensation through several channels. Here's a breakdown of the significant types:
| Type of Compensation | Description |
|---|---|
| Asbestos Trust Funds | Numerous companies that manufactured or utilized asbestos have actually set up trust funds for victims. |
| Lawsuits Against Employers | Victims can file accident or wrongful death lawsuits against responsible parties. |
| Veterans Benefits | Veterans exposed to asbestos throughout military service may certify for compensation through VA benefits. |
| Social Security Disability | People disabled by mesothelioma may receive Social Security benefits. |
| Employees' Compensation | Staff members detected with mesothelioma may be eligible for compensation through their employer. |
1. Asbestos Trust Funds
Due to the extensive use of asbestos, lots of business have actually declared bankruptcy and produced trust funds to compensate victims. These funds can supply significant financial relief. It's important to work with a lawyer experienced in asbestos litigation to navigate these trusts.
2. Lawsuits Against Employers
Louisiana homeowners can pursue legal action against their companies if they were exposed to asbestos at work. Injury lawsuits allow victims to look for damages for medical expenditures, lost salaries, and pain and suffering, while wrongful death lawsuits can provide compensation to the households of departed victims.
3. Veterans Benefits
Lots of veterans, particularly those who served in the Navy or in shipbuilding industries, have actually experienced asbestos exposure. The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) supplies impairment compensation and healthcare for veterans detected with mesothelioma.
4. Social Security Disability
Individuals unable to work due to mesothelioma may certify for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I). The Social Security Administration (SSA) acknowledges mesothelioma as a terminal illness, allowing for a possibly expedited evaluation process.
5. Workers' Compensation
If diagnosed with mesothelioma as an outcome of workplace exposure, individuals might be entitled to employees' compensation advantages despite fault. This can cover medical costs, wage replacement, and more.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How long do I have to sue for mesothelioma compensation in Louisiana?
A1: Louisiana has an one-year statute of restrictions for individual injury claims, and three years for wrongful death claims. It is crucial to act quickly to ensure your eligibility for compensation.
Q2: Can I file a claim if I was a secondary victim of asbestos exposure?
A2: Yes, people who have been affected by secondary exposure (for instance, member of the family who lived with a worker exposed to asbestos) may also submit claims.
Q3: How much compensation can I expect for mesothelioma?
A3: Compensation amounts differ commonly based upon medical costs, lost earnings, and pain and suffering. Victims can get settlements varying from thousands to millions of dollars.
Q4: Do I require a legal representative to sue?
A4: While it's possible to file a claim separately, having a skilled mesothelioma attorney can greatly boost your opportunities of getting optimum compensation.
Q5: What documents do I need for suing?
A5: Essential documents include medical records, evidence of asbestos exposure, employment history, and financial records associated with lost income or medical expenses.
